Residents went to the polls on Thursday, July 30, to fill the vacant seat, with voting taking place at Picket Piece Village Hall and Picket Twenty Community Centre. Independent candidate Thomas James was elected with 294 votes. Liberal Democrat candidate Josie Msonthi received 126 votes.
